Kaley and Karl, always in the news one way or another, made major headlines in March 2020 for ending their "unconventional marriage" and finally living together. The two reside in Kaley's $12 million Hidden Hills estate, where the global pandemic has also brought 32-year-old Briana Cuoco staying with them.

Opening up to Jimmy Kimmel, Kaley revealed: "We've been married for a year and a half, been together for almost four years and this quarantine has forced us to actually move in together," adding that it was "great" for the relationship.
